Shubman Gill Heroics in India’s Narrow Loss to Bangladesh

Highlights of the Match


In a thrilling encounter between India and Bangladesh during the Asia Cup Super 4s, Shubman Gill remarkable century couldn’t save India from a narrow defeat. Despite Gill’s 121 runs off 133 balls and Axar Patel’s quick 42 off 34 balls, India fell short by just six runs. Bangladesh’s Mustafizur Rahman played a pivotal role, claiming three crucial wickets, including that of Axar Patel during the penultimate over, which turned the tide in Bangladesh’s favor.

Asia Cup Performance


The Asia Cup 2023 has seen some stellar performances, and this match was no exception. Earlier in the Bangladesh innings, Ravindra Jadeja achieved a significant milestone, joining the ranks of Kapil Dev by scoring 2,000 runs and taking 200 wickets. However, Bangladesh’s captain showcased a stylish knock, setting a target of 265 for India. Shakib Al Hasan, with his impeccable skills, steadied Bangladesh’s innings when they were struggling at 15 for two. His partnership with Towhid Hridoy added a crucial 101 runs, setting a competitive total for India.
